    Native Americans from the Valley of the Sun and Arizona

    Native Americans have a deep-rooted history in the Valley of the Sun (Metro Phoenix), with several tribes having lived in the area for thousands of years. The Salt River Pima-Maricopa Indian Community and the Gila River Indian Community are two prominent tribes in the area, both with thriving communities and cultural traditions.   Many Native Americans in the Valley of the Sun have strong connections to their heritage, participating in traditional ceremonies, arts, and festivals. The tribes also play a significant role in the economic development of the region, with tribal businesses and casinos contributing to the local economy.   Despite facing challenges such as discrimination and disparities in health and education, Native Americans in the Valley of the Sun continue to celebrate and preserve their rich cultural legacy, making important contributions to the diverse tapestry of Metro Phoenix.   Arizona is home to 22 federally recognized Native American tribes, which is the second-highest number of tribal communities in the United States. These tribes have diverse cultures, traditions, and languages, contributing to the rich tapestry of Native American heritage in Arizona.   There are several Native American tribes in Arizona, each with unique histories, cultures, and traditions. Some of the main tribes in the state include:   1️⃣ Navajo Nation: The Navajo Nation is the largest federally recognized tribe in the United States, with a reservation that spans parts of Arizona, New Mexico, and Utah.   2️⃣ Apache Tribes: There are several Apache tribes in Arizona, including the White Mountain Apache Tribe, San Carlos Apache Tribe, and the Fort Apache Reservation.   3️⃣ Tohono O'odham Nation: The Tohono O'odham Nation is the second largest tribe in Arizona, with a reservation located in the southern part of the state.   4️⃣ Hopi Tribe: The Hopi Tribe is known for their rich cultural traditions, including their intricate art and ceremonial dances.
